Analysis
In 2023, imports of low carbon technology products, us dollar (world), per in Tunisia stood at 0.0211 units per US$ of GDP.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.6% on the previous year and up 4.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, imports of low carbon technology products, us dollar (world), per in Tunisia peaked at 0.0247 units per US$ of GDP in 2011 and was at its lowest, 0.0122 units per US$ of GDP, in 1999.
Tunisia ranks 33rd of 186 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 30 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Imports of low carbon technology products, US dollar (World)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Imports of low carbon technology products, US dollar (World) ÷ GDP (current US$)
Computed from
- Imports of low carbon technology products, US dollar International Monetary Fund
- GDP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
